What is a Lightweight All Terrain Stroller?
A lightweight all-terrain stroller integrates the advantages of portability and flexibility. These strollers are created to navigate varied surfaces, such as gravel, lawn, and rough paths while being light enough for parents to bring easily. They usually include sturdy wheels, durable products, and a simple folding mechanism, making them best for on-the-go households.

What age is ideal for using an all-terrain stroller?
All-terrain strollers are generally ideal for kids from birth as much as around 5 years of ages. Many models feature baby automobile seat compatibility or recline function, permitting their use from infancy.
2. Can lightweight all-terrain strollers be used for running?
Some designs, such as the BOB Revolution Flex and Thule Urban Glide, are specifically designed for jogging. However, always inspect the maker's specifications to ensure that it is safe for jogging.
3. Are all-terrain strollers heavy?
Not always! A lightweight all-terrain stroller usually weighs in between 14-27 pounds, differentiating it from standard all-terrain strollers which can be bulkier.
4. Can I use a lightweight all-terrain stroller on rough terrain?
Yes, these strollers are created to handle a variety of surfaces, including gravel, yard, and dirt courses, making them suitable for outdoor experiences.
5. How compact are lightweight all-terrain strollers when folded?
The majority of lightweight all-terrain strollers include a one-handed folding mechanism that allows them to be compact and simple to store in vehicles or tight areas.
